Understanding Bay Windows
Before diving into the renovation procedure, it's vital to understand what specifies a bay window. Generally, a bay window consists of three primary components:
Center Window: A big repaired pane that provides a broad view.Side Windows: Two extra windows on either side that are normally operable, enabling ventilation.Base or Seat: A ledge or seating area that can be integrated into the design.Benefits of Renovating a Bay Window

Prior to starting a bay window renovation, homeowners must think about several factors to guarantee a successful job.
1. Examining the Condition of the Existing Window
Before remodellings are started, it is essential to evaluate the condition of the existing bay window. House owners need to examine for signs of wear and tear, wetness damage, and structural stability. If the window frame is rotting or if there are extensive drafts, it might be essential to replace the whole unit rather than simply refurbish.
2. Setting a Budget
It's crucial to establish a practical budget before starting any renovation job. Costs can differ extensively based upon design options, products, and labor. Here's a basic budget plan breakdown:

As soon as preparing and preparation are complete, property owners can begin the renovation procedure. This can be broken down into a few crucial actions.
Preparation and Measurements: Before any work begins, determining the existing bay window and going over particular design aspects with contractors is important.
Picking a Contractor: Selecting an experienced specialist who specializes in window installations is essential for attaining ideal outcomes. Obtaining numerous quotes and reviewing previous work can help in the decision-making procedure.
Removing Old Window Components: The existing frame and glass will need to be thoroughly removed. It's vital to ensure that no additional damage is triggered to surrounding areas.
Installing the New Window: New frames and glass will be set up. Correct insulation is important during this action to prevent future drafts and guarantee energy effectiveness.
Completing Touches: Finalizing the renovation with trim, molding, and any additional features like window seats or shelves will finalize the visual appeal of the bay window.
Frequently Asked Questions About Bay Window Renovation
1. The length of time does a bay window renovation take?The duration can vary, but a total renovation typically takes between one to 2 weeks, depending upon the complexity and size of the project.
2. Can I DIY a bay window renovation?While some property owners might select a DIY approach, it's suggested to work with a professional. Bay windows require exact measurements and installation to guarantee functionality and security.
3. Are there any permits required for a bay window renovation?Allowing requirements depend upon local regulations and the scale of the renovation. It's best practice to consult your local structure authority before beginning.
